Fresno State Women's Basketball 2015 NIT Tournament Capsule

Fresno State Bulldogs
Mountain West (22-9, 13-5)

 

Big Wins: 11/28 at San Diego (93-88), 12/12 St. Mary’s (60-56), 1/31 Colorado State (53-49)
Bad Losses: 11/30 at CS Bakersfield (60-80), 2/4 at San Jose State (51-56), 2/11 UNLV (70-73)
Coach: Jaime White

Probable Starters:
Shauqunna Collins, Junior, Guard, 7.9 ppg, 2.1 apg, 2.0 spg
Robin Draper, Senior, Guard, 4.3 ppg, 1.1 apg
Alex Furr, Senior, Guard, 7.4 ppg, 1.6 apg
Alex Sheedy, Senior, Forward, 16.5 ppg, 7.3 rpg
Toni Smith, Junior, Center, 8.5 ppg, 4.8 rpg

Key Roleplayers:
Bego Faz Davalos, Freshman, Center, 5.3 ppg, 6.6 rpg, 3.1 bpg
Raven Fox, Senior, Guard, 8.4 ppg, 2.4 apg, 2.2 spg

By the Numbers:
Scoring Offense: 64.0 (178th in nation, 6th in conference)
Scoring Defense: 58.8 (57, 2)
Field-Goal Percentage: 40.5 (138, 4)
Field-Goal Defense: 37.7 (77, 3)
Three-Point Field Goals Per Game: 4.8 (197, 5)
Three-Point Field-Goal Percentage: 29.0 (251, 5)
Free-Throw Percentage: 69.1 (162, 5)
Rebound Margin: 2.9 (92, 5)
Assists Per Game: 12.3 (211, 8)
Turnovers Per Game: 18.3 (281, 9)

Recent Postseason Appearances:
2014    NCAA    First Round loss to Nebraska
2013    NCAA    Round of 64 loss to California
2012    NCAA    Round of 64 loss to Georgetown
2011    NCAA    Round of 64 loss to North Carolina
2010    NCAA    Round of 64 loss to Baylor
2009    NCAA    Round of 64 loss to California
2008    NCAA    Round of 64 loss to Baylor
2006    NIT    Opening Round win over UC Santa Barbara
2006    NIT    First Round win over UNLV
2006    NIT    Second Round loss to Kansas State

*all team stats through 3/5
